What s the distance between point A -3 2 and point B 5 -1?

It is the square root of (-3-5)2+(2--1)2 = 8.544 to 3 decimal places

What is the midpoint of the segment from Point A 6 3 to Point B 8 1?

The mid point is at the mean average of each of the coordinates: The midpoint between A (6,3) and and B (8,1) is (6+8/2, 3+1/2) = (7, 2)

What is Halfway between two points is what?

The point half way between two points consists of the mean average of the coordinates of the two points:If the two points are (X0, Yo) and (X1, Y1) then the halfway point is:((Xo + X1) ÷ 2, (Yo + Y1) ÷ 2)For example, the halfway point between (1, 5) and (-3, 7) is:((1 + -3) ÷ 2, (5 + 7) ÷ 2) = (-2 ÷ 2, 12 ÷ 2)= (-1, 6)The midpointThe midpoint
